A Sacrificial Offering to the Kingdom of Heaven in a Cracked Dog's Ear CD, 2009
(Reference #RSR200)
Re-recording of their seminal 1998 album, 'S.U.i.Z.i.D.' with the psychopathological and grotesquely self-mutilated Niklas Kvarforth of SHINING on vocals. The atmosphere is faithful to the original, but the songs are in a different order and the lyrics (completely deranged) are in English.

Dark Metal DG, 2005 (1994)
(Reference #RSR0117DG)
Digipak version of their classic debut, reissued with bonus material: the track 'Wintermute' from their EP 'Thy Pale Dominion', and two live tracks from 1993. All tracks digitally remastered and the entire design is re-done with never before seen photos and lyrics!

S.U.i.Z.i.D. CD, 1998
(Reference #RSR0118)
Dark morbid disturbing and utterly brilliant. A bleak oppressive atmosphere of depression and suicide like its predecessors but more technical and eclectic. Features a demented, miserable Marco Kehren of the blackly depressive DEINONYCHUS on vocals.
